PORTABLE (POWER OPERATED) TOOLS AND EQUIPMENT

____ Are grinders, saws and similar equipment provided with appropriate safety guards?

____ Are power tools used with the correct shield, guard, or attachment recommended by the manufacturer?

____ Are portable circular saws equipped with guards above and below the base shoe?

____ Are circular saw guards checked to assure they are not wedged up, thus leaving the lower portion of the blade unguarded?

____ Are rotating or moving parts of equipment guarded to prevent physical contact?

____ Are all cord-connected, electrically-operated tools and equipment effectively grounded or of the approved double insulated type?

____ Are effective guards in place over belts, pulleys, chains, sprockets, on equipment such as concrete mixers, air compressors, etc.?

____ Are portable fans provided with full guards or screens having openings ½ inch or less?

____ Is hoisting equipment available and used for lifting heavy objects, and are hoist ratings and characteristics appropriate for the task?

____ Are ground-fault circuit interrupters provided on all temporary electrical 15 and 20 ampere circuits, used during periods of construction?

____ Are pneumatic and hydraulic hoses on power-operated tools checked regularly for deterioration or damage?
